The Department of Biological Sciences at Duquesne University, Pittsburgh PA, invites applications for a full-time tenure-track Assistant Professor. Successful candidates will join a group of faculty with expertise in cell biology, molecular biology, physiology, microbiology, evolutionary and ecological genetics, and neuroscience working within a robust and collaborative research environment across departments and schools on campus. Additional information about the Department can be found at http://(Use the "Apply for this Job" box below).
Duquesne University enrolls approximately 8,500 graduate and undergraduate students and is located in downtown Pittsburgh, which is consistently ranked among the most livable cities in the United States, with numerous educational, cultural, and recreational opportunities.
Duquesne is committed to the teacher-scholar model, where excellence is expected in both education and research. The successful applicant will establish a rigorous, externally funded independent research program that leverages modern approaches to investigate key questions in cell and molecular biology, broadly defined. Teaching responsibilities will include courses in cell biology, molecular biology, and/or immunology. Applicants are expected to mentor PhD and undergraduate students in their laboratory.
Competitive salary and start-up packages are available.

Requirements:
Applicants must possess a PhD and have post-doctoral experience.
APPLICATION INSTRUCTIONS:
Applicants should submit a cover letter, CV, 1-2 page statement of research, and 1 page teaching philosophy, and arrange for three letters of recommendation. All application materials should be submitted via Interfolio. Review of applications will begin October 31st, 2025 and continue until the position is filled.
